Immobiliere Dassault 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Calculation

Dividend Yield % and dividend growth of a stock is an important factor for income investors. But if company A raises its dividend constantly faster than company B, company A's future dividend yield might be much higher than Company B's even if their yields are the same now and their stock prices do not change.

Yield on Cost assumes that you buy and the stock today, and hold it for 5 years. If the company raises it dividends at the same rate as it did over the past 5 years, the dividends investors receive annually in 5 years relative to the stock price today.

Therefore, Yield-on-Cost of Immobiliere Dassault is calculated as

Yield-on-Cost=Dividend Yield %*(1+Dividend Growth Rate)^5

Immobiliere Dassault  (XPAR:IMDA) 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Explanation

Of course the risk here is that the company may not raise its dividends as it did before. The key is to select the companies that can consistently raise its dividends. Usually companies with long history of raising dividends tend to do so.

Immobiliere Dassault SA is a France-based real estate company. It owns and manages the office and residential real estate properties. The company's objective is to progressively grow its real estate portfolio in the prime sector of Paris, with a medium and long-term heritage focus, focusing mainly on high-quality office and retail properties.
